No Blacklist Yet for Islamic State Banks
Why the United States isn't using its biggest financial weapon against banks in the Islamist militant group's territory.
http://www.foreignpolicy.com/articles/2014/11/12/iraq_syria_blacklist_sanction_islamic_state_banks_ ISIS_IS
In June, the Islamic State of Iraq and al-Sham (ISIS) militants inspired fear and awe when they swept into Iraq's second-biggest city, Mosul, and reports spread that they looted the city's banks and walked away with more than $400 million.
